Towel End

This is a Towel end. It is dated 19th century and we acquired it in 1901. Its medium is silk and metallic threads on cotton foundation and its technique is embroidered on plain weave. It is a part of the Textiles department.

This object was bequest of Mrs. Charles E. Whitehead.

Its dimensions are

H x W: 12.7 x 50.8 cm (5 x 20 in.)
